Betting Tip: Both teams to score

Both these sides sit on zero points with a disastrous -9 goal difference, hardly an ideal start to the campaign for Mikel Arteta and Daniel Farke. To be fair to the two gaffers they’ve both had to face Manchester City away, Arsenal have also played Chelsea whilst Norwich have had Leicester and Liverpool.

It’s a great chance for both sides to get their first point or points on the board and I think Norwich will go for it, they have nothing to fear or lose here and can count themselves much more unfortunate than Arsenal to be pointless thus far. The Canaries have an xG goal difference of just -2.4 whereas the Gunners are right down at -6.8.

Arsenal at around 1/2 just makes you shiver, they should score past a Norwich defence that wasn’t even that strong in the Championship but there’s plenty of mistakes in the home sides’ rear-guard so the 10/11 on both teams to score could well be worth a look.

Betting Tip: Kieran Tierney to be carded

I’ll also have a nibble on Arsenal left-back Kieran Tierney to be carded at a juicy 15/2. The Scotsman will be up against the lively Todd Cantwell who has drawn the 5th most fouls in the league this season, he was also fouled on average 2.7 times per game last season.
